Transaction 15a620e4a93c7c7965958d8933418952781a54726d04db1f2e1f0e79e3316331

3 Input
2 Outputs
  • 15a620e4a93c7c7965958d8933418952781a54726d04db1f2e1f0e79e3316331:0
  • value  51478
    address  32NURx4FN36x2Cw7NtPY3N1owt4zCuPZtL
  • 15a620e4a93c7c7965958d8933418952781a54726d04db1f2e1f0e79e3316331:1
  • value  1761
    address  bc1qcuc5xcgm37xr7redkp7fwz3ks9ujqw90vres4l